Calculate Log Base 24 of 75

To solve the equation log 24 (75)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 75, a = 24:
    log 24 (75) = log(75) / log(24)
  3. Evaluate the term:
    log(75) / log(24)
    = 1.39794000867204 / 1.92427928606188
    = 1.3585320903968
